When you click "free returns," someone pays. Usually, it's the planet.

The average online return travels 2,600 miles before reaching a warehouse. Roughly 25% of returned clothing is never resold โ€” it goes straight to landfill.

Some startups are rethinking the model entirely. Tryon uses AR to let customers visualize clothing on their actual body measurements. Early data shows a 40% reduction in return rates.

The era of consequence-free returns is ending.
